jQuery beheersen in Shopify: Een uitgebreide gids voor versterkers

Inhoudsopgave

  1. Inleiding
  2. Wat is jQuery en waarom gebruiken in Shopify?
  3. Controleren op jQuery in uw Shopify-thema
  4. Hoe voeg ik jQuery toe aan mijn Shopify-winkel
  5. jQuery gebruiken voor functionaliteitsverbeteringen in Shopify
  6. Beste praktijken bij het gebruik van jQuery in Shopify
  7. Problemen met jQuery oplossen
  8. FAQ-sectie
  9. Conclusie

Inleiding

Bent u nieuwsgierig hoe u jQuery naadloos kunt integreren in uw Shopify-site om functionaliteit en gebruikerservaring te verbeteren? Naarmate meer bedrijven migreren naar online platforms, is het essentieel om dynamische en interactieve e-commerce sites te creëren die de aandacht en loyaliteit van klanten trekken. jQuery, een veelgebruikte JavaScript-bibliotheek, kan een effectief hulpmiddel zijn om dit te bereiken, en het robuuste e-commerceplatform van Shopify biedt een vruchtbare bodem voor jQuery-integratie. In dit blogbericht zullen we het proces ontrafelen van het gebruik van jQuery in Shopify, waarbij we de stappen blootleggen die nodig zijn om deze krachtige bibliotheek in het ontwerp en de werking van uw winkel te injecteren.

Wat is jQuery en waarom gebruiken in Shopify?

jQuery begrijpen

jQuery is een beknopte en efficiënte JavaScript-bibliotheek die veelvoorkomende webtaken zoals DOM-manipulatie, gebeurtenishantering en animatie vereenvoudigt. Het biedt ontwikkelaars een eenvoudigere syntaxis, compatibiliteit met meerdere browsers en de mogelijkheid om functionaliteiten uit te breiden met plugins.

Voordelen in Shopify

jQuery integreren in Shopify kan de interactiviteit van uw winkel verbeteren, van het toevoegen van animaties tot het stroomlijnen van formulierinzendingen. Met meer dynamische pagina's kunnen klanten de site boeiender vinden, wat mogelijk kan leiden tot verhoogde conversies.

Controleren op jQuery in uw Shopify-thema

Voordat u jQuery toevoegt of ermee werkt, is het essentieel om te controleren of het al is opgenomen in uw Shopify-thema: - Maak gebruik van de ontwikkelaarstools van de browser of controleer de bestanden van het thema. - Voer jQuery.fn.jquery uit in de console om de versie te achterhalen. - Voorkom het laden van meerdere versies om conflicten en laadproblemen te voorkomen.

Hoe voeg ik jQuery toe aan mijn Shopify-winkel

Als uw thema jQuery niet heeft geladen of uw activiteiten een specifieke versie van jQuery vereisen, zo kunt u het includeren:

Via CDN

Door jQuery van een Content Delivery Network (CDN) te implementeren, wordt een snelle, gedistribueerde levering van de bibliotheek gegarandeerd: 1. Zoek de <head> tag in theme.liquid. 2. Voeg het CDN-scripttag toe voor de vereiste versie van jQuery, net voor </head>.

Met Lokale Middelen

Voor verbeterde controle en beveiliging, sla een lokale kopie van jQuery op in uw assetsmap: 1. Download het jQuery-bestand en voeg het toe aan de assets van uw thema. 2. Link dit bestand in uw themalayout direct na waar jQuery zou worden geladen als het van een CDN afkomstig was.

jQuery gebruiken voor functionaliteitsverbeteringen in Shopify

Zodra jQuery is ingesteld, haal er het maximale uit met verschillende scripts voor verbeterde prestaties en visuele dynamiek: - DOM-manipulatie: Gebruik jQuery om elementen in de DOM te wijzigen of nieuwe te creëren, wat dynamische contentupdates mogelijk maakt. - Gebeurtenishantering: Gebruik de methoden van jQuery om gebruikersinteracties zoals klikken en mouseovers te behandelen, waardoor een responsievere ervaring ontstaat. - Animatie: Genereer subtiele animaties voor overgangen tussen staten of tijdens paginainteracties voor boeiende visuele effecten. - Slider's maken: Implementeer jQuery-plugins om intuïtieve en interactieve afbeeldingslider's of carrousels te maken die producten aantrekkelijk presenteren. - Formulier validatie: Voer on-page validaties in voor formulieren, zodat alle ingevoerde gegevens correct zijn vóór verzending, waardoor de gebruikerslijn wordt gladgestreken.

Beste praktijken bij het gebruik van jQuery in Shopify

Prestatie-optimalisatie

  • Laad scripts asynchroon om pagina's sneller te laden.
  • Gebruik gebeurtenisdelegatie voor beter geheugenbeheer.

Codebeheer

  • Maak ruim gebruik van opmerkingen om de scriptfunctionaliteit toe te lichten.
  • Houd u aan benamingconventies die samenvloeien met de rest van uw codebase.

Regelmatige Updates en Onderhoud

  • Blijf op de hoogte van nieuwere versies of patches die bugfixes, compatibiliteitsverbeteringen of nieuwe functies kunnen bevatten.
  • Audit en verfijn periodiek uw jQuery-code voor prestaties, waarbij overtolligheden worden verwijderd waar deze worden aangetroffen.

Problemen met jQuery oplossen

Veelvoorkomende valkuilen

  • Fouten in functiescope of spellingsfouten die scriptuitvoering kunnen belemmeren.
  • Pluginconflicten, met name als er meerdere versies of potentieel onderling onverenigbare plugins worden geladen.

Tips voor het oplossen van problemen

  • Maak tijdens ontwikkeling uitgebreid gebruik van console logs om variabelenstaten of functie-uitvoering te monitoren.
  • Bekijk de console van de browser voor fouten en let op de feedback die wordt gegeven om problemen te identificeren.

FAQ-sectie

V: Hoe zorg ik ervoor dat jQuery de laadsnelheid van mijn site niet beïnvloedt? A: Laad jQuery en andere scripts asynchroon, geef prioriteit aan het laden van vitale scripts en beperk de afhankelijkheid van grote, externe plugins.

V: Kan het gebruik van jQuery SEO-implicaties hebben voor mijn Shopify-winkel? A: Overmatig gebruik kan de laadsnelheden beïnvloeden, wat een rankingfactor is. Echter, verstandig gebruik, vooral ter verbetering van de gebruikerservaring, kan SEO-voordelen opleveren.

V: Kan jQuery worden gebruikt voor op maat gemaakte winkel-API's? A: Ja, jQuery kan worden gebruikt om AJAX-oproepen te doen naar Shopify Admin API of Storefront API voor het dynamisch ophalen of plaatsen van gegevens.

V: Hoe ga ik om met jQuery-conflicten in Shopify? A: Implementeer jQuery's noConflict() om de controle over de $-variabele terug te geven aan welk script het oorspronkelijk gebruikte.

V: Zijn er alternatieven voor jQuery voor animatie in Shopify? A: CSS3 biedt native animatiemogelijkheden die kunnen worden gebruikt voor prestatievriendelijke animaties zonder het JavaScript aan te roepen.

Conclusie

jQuery integreren in uw Shopify-winkel opent een overvloed aan mogelijkheden om de functionaliteit en esthetiek van uw online aanwezigheid te verhogen. Terwijl er veel te winnen valt met deze krachtige combinatie, zorgt naleving van de beste praktijken ervoor dat de voordelen worden geplukt zonder afbreuk te doen aan prestaties of gebruikerservaring. Onthoud dat technologie zou moeten versterken en nooit afleiden van het kerndoel - uw klanten efficiënt en voortreffelijk bedienen via uw Shopify-winkel.